About Arcadis & the Role
As an Arcadian, you help deliver world-leading sustainable design, engineering, and consultancy solutions for natural and built assets as part of our global business of 34,000 people across 30+ countries. We’re dedicated to improving quality of life—and together, curious minds solve the world’s most complex challenges and drive meaningful impact.
We’re looking for two Recruitment Administrators to join our Talent Acquisition team and support the delivery of a high-volume internal hiring project (6-month fixed-term contract, with potential extension).
In this role, you’ll provide essential coordination and administrative support across the end-to-end recruitment process, ensuring smooth efficiency while delivering a positive experience for both candidates and hiring managers.
This uniquely dynamic position is ideal for someone looking to gain hands-on recruitment experience, or build on existing administrative or coordination skills in a fast-paced environment.
Full training on our in-house recruitment systems will be provided, alongside on-the-job support from the Talent Acquisition team.
Key Accountabilities
As a Recruitment Administrator, you’ll support daily recruitment operations while contributing to successful hiring outcomes. Your core responsibilities include:

-
Shortlisting support
- Reviewing applications against defined criteria
-
Interview coordination
- Organising interview panels, communicating with candidates, and engaging stakeholders
-
Im/backend applicant tracking
- Maintaining and updating the Applicant Tracking System (ATS)
- Ensuring data accuracy, compliance, and integrity at every stage
-
Candidate experience management
- Serving as a primary point of contact, providing timely updates, and fostering a positive candidate journey
-
Process efficiency & progress tracking
- Chasing and collating feedback from hiring managers to keep recruitment moving at pace
-
Onboarding & offer management
- Assisting with offer documentation preparation and onboarding administration
-
High-volume recruitment prioritisation
- Managing multiple concurrent vacancies while ensuring deadlines are met
-
Process compliance & quality assurance
- Adhering to best practices, ensuring consistent application of recruitment procedures
-
General administrative support
- Providing operational assistance to the Talent Acquisition team during peak activity
Requirements & Qualifications
Proven ability and experience in recruitment coordination, administration, or similar support roles, with the following strengths:
✅ Strong organisational skills – managing multitasking in fast-paced environments

✅ Confident communicator – ability to engage at all levels with candidates and stakeholders, demonstrating attention to detail in data and documentation management
✅ Proactive and resourceful attitude – adaptable, initiative-driven, and able to efficiently use systems/solutions (ATS experience is a plus)
✅ Fluent in English – additional European languages advantageous
✅ Collaborative mind-set: A commitment to delivering high-quality service and fostering a positive team environment
